There aren't too many Android apps for plant identification, especially if you want something more comprehensive than "100 Favorite Wildflowers". In the past, if you wanted to ID a rare or unusual species, you had to bring a fat heavy book and wade through traditional keys. This one claims to have everything with in Washington with a corolla. That leaves out a lot of plants - conifers, grasses, sedges, rushes, ferns and their allies - but it still leaves 2286 species, over twice as many as any other app. The keys are easy to use and reasonably accurate. For difficult groups (like yellow composites) I have found that I sometimes have to run a plant several times before I get to a confident ID, but it's still easier and quicker than using a traditional key. The photos and attribute lists are great; the descriptions tend to be pretty skimpy. The bottom line is that since I got this app, all the other botany books get left in camp. It lacks some features I would like. You can't give it a list of known plants in a geographic area.
